Massachusetts payer mix and prior auth volume

Massachusetts runs roughly 65% commercial / 25% Medicare and Medicare Advantage / 10% MassHealth Medicaid in private practice. Blue Cross Blue Shield of Massachusetts, Harvard Pilgrim, Tufts Health Plan, and Mass General Brigham Health Plan drive most prior auth volume; MassHealth managed care plans (Tufts Together, WellSense, Mass General Brigham) dominate Medicaid eligibility checks.

Compliance and licensing notes for Massachusetts practices

Massachusetts 201 CMR 17.00 (Standards for the Protection of Personal Information) and Chapter 93H layer on top of HIPAA, requiring a written Information Security Program (WISP) and immediate breach notification. What a Massachusetts prior authorization specialist does

Our prior authorization specialists pick auths off the worklist inside your EHR, prepare submissions with the right clinical justification, and follow them to completion - including peer-to-peer appeals when required. They are trained on the most common categories: imaging (MRI, CT), brand-name medications (GLP-1s, biologics, brand insulins), DME, specialist referrals on Medicare Advantage, surgical procedures, and home health.

Daily responsibilities

  • Daily submission of prior auths through CoverMyMeds, payer portals, and fax
  • Clinical documentation packaging and submission
  • Status calls and follow-up on pending auths
  • Denial work and peer-to-peer appeal coordination
  • Patient and provider notification on approval/denial
